Now, some history and a few highlights.
While still in high school in the mid 1970's, Dean experimented with tape manipulation, that included looping, splicing, field recordings,and processing them through effects that were available at the time...a crude form of what is now called sound design.This was also the time of his first review in "Rolling Stone" as a guitarist in 1976.
1976-79:
Straight from high school Dean managed an import record store that sold progressive rock, Krautrock and electronic music.
While working there he joined the band Whirlywirld playing guitar and effects releasing two E.P.'s "Window To The World" and "Eyebrows Still Shaved",
1979-82:
Dean formed a new band called "Equal Local", releasing two E.P.'s "Madagascar" and "Yank" as well as a compilation of live performances "How Did We Miss These".
Cannes Film Festival Award: 1981 Winner Best Short Film "Mass Movement"
Sydney Symphony Orchestra: Dance Production "Terra Sect" wrote and conducted.
The Fourth International Bienalle Audio: Wrote and Performed 2 compositions.
1982-85:
Director of Music - Party Architecure & Australian Fashion Design Council writing,performing and engineering many fashion shows including the haute couture designs of Vanessa Leyonhjelm in New York, Chicago and Dallas.
Formed a 23 piece big band, playing original compositions called "Hot Half Hour" released a 4 song E.P.
Assistant Director/Chief Engineer/Trainer for the Australian National Program Service (produced & engineered talk/news/music programs throughout Australian,Asian and American Public Radio Stations.
Recorded two Soundtracks "Run For Their Lives and "On The Brink" for the United Nations American Red Cross famine relief in Ethiopia.
Played guitar on the soundtrack "Dogs In Space" (Win/Lose and Rooms For The Memory) with Michael Hutchense.
Co wrote 3 songs for the Stephen Cummings release "This Wonderful Life"
Landed worldwide songwriting/publishing deals with Polygram and E.M.I. which included song submissions and recordings for the Eurythmics.
1985-97:
Department Director/Lecturer Of Songwriting - Australian College Of Entertainers. Wrote the syllabus.
Co- wrote songs on three more Stephen Cummings C.D.'s. "Lovetown", "A New Kind Of Blue" which received the A.R.I.A (Australian Record Industry Award), 1990 Winner Best Adult Rock. "Good Humour" receiving 1991 Winner Best Alternative Album.
1997-2007:
Worked with a Florida music store called Music Showcase as their District Music Education Sales Manager, which encompassed the Hillsborough,Pasco,Pinellas and Polk counties.
This position included public speaking engagements both motivational and for teaching recording techniques to students from the Elementary/(Primary) school level through to University graduates. This also meant liasing with the resource/law enforcement officers within each school.

Thoughts on "Thoughts..."

Writing about this album takes me back to 1977, where I cut up my brother's bicycle with a hacksaw to create my version of windchimes/bell sounds. I drilled holes in each part of what was left of his bicycle, and hung them with fishing line on a home-made frame...hitting them and recording whatever sounded good.
I then recorded the sounds of the spokes of the wheels, from said bicycle, as I turned them with the pedal mechanism, using forks or other things that would make a curious sound.

The Hotel Story

Through the fogsmoke of southern humidity, I found and bought a little place amongst grandfather oaks that were covered with spanish moss and creepers in Zephyrhills, Florida, I called it my hotel. It was the place I became Disturbed Earth and put that name to the music I had been doing since the late 70's.
